Why is it important for diagnosticians to consider language during evaluations?

Considering language during evaluations is crucial for ensuring that the assessment results are valid across different demographics. Language can significantly impact a child's performance on tests and evaluations; for example, a child's proficiency in the language of the assessment may not accurately reflect their cognitive abilities or potential.

When diagnosticians are aware of the linguistic backgrounds of the students they evaluate, they can take into account factors such as language differences, dialects, and cultural contexts. This awareness not only contributes to a more accurate assessment of a student's strengths and weaknesses but also helps in identifying any linguistic barriers that may affect the child's educational performance. By focusing on these elements, diagnosticians can provide more equitable assessments and ensure that students from diverse backgrounds have their capabilities accurately and fairly represented.
